Abstract: Mazu culture is an important part of Chinese traditional culture, and its patterns are widely inherited and used as cultural symbols. With the development of contemporary society, the symbolic meaning and expression of patterns in Mazu culture are constantly changing and evolving. This article aims to explore the symbolic meaning and expression of patterns in Mazu culture in the context of contemporary society, so as to better inherit and promote Mazu culture. This article aims to explore the connotation and extension of Mazu culture by analyzing the symbolic meaning and expression of patterns in Mazu culture, and provide theoretical reference for promoting the development and inheritance of Mazu culture. At the same time, the research results of this paper are helpful to enrich the diversity of social culture and improve people's awareness and attention to traditional culture. This study adopts the method of combining literature data method and field investigation method. First of all, by consulting a large amount of literature, systematically sort out the relevant information on the basic characteristics, symbolic meaning and expression methods of patterns in Mazu culture. Secondly, combined with the data collected in the field survey, the current situation of patterns in Mazu culture is analyzed and summarized. This study found that the symbolic meaning of patterns in Mazu culture includes religious belief, regional culture, historical heritage and humanistic spirit. At the same time, the expressions of patterns in Mazu culture are also diverse, including painting, carving, weaving and embroidery, enamel and metal and other techniques. In the context of contemporary society, the inheritance and development of patterns in Mazu culture is facing many challenges, such as marketization, shallow culture and formalization. To this end, this paper puts forward some suggestions and suggestions, such as strengthening cultural inheritance education, emphasizing cultural innovation and improving the level of cultural consciousness. This article makes an in-depth discussion on the symbolic meaning and expression of patterns in Mazu culture in the context of contemporary society, discovers some problems and challenges, and puts forward some suggestions and suggestions. It is believed that these research results can play an important role in promoting the inheritance, innovation and development of Mazu culture, and also provide methods and ideas for in-depth research and promotion of Chinese traditional culture.
